•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

lsm / neokai / 27874317081 / 28
82%
dev: 82%

Build:
DEFAULT BRANCH: dev
Ran 20 Jun 2026 02:42PM UTC
Files 355
Run time 8s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

20 Jun 2026 02:39PM UTC coverage: 19.096%. Remained the same
27874317081.28

push

github

web-flow
Show worker agents in space config (#2122)

* feat: show worker agents in space config

Derive configure-tab agent cards from workflow node definitions so long-horizon agents remain isolated to the Agents page.

* fix: load workflow details for worker agents

Populate configure views from full workflow definitions so worker-agent cards and counts reflect production workflow summaries.

* fix: add workflowDetails to SpaceIsland mock

Prevents "Cannot read properties of undefined" crash when SpaceConfigurePage reads spaceStore.workflowDetails in tests.

* fix: harden workflow details bulk load and prefer custom prompts

Clear workflowDetailCache and filter batch against current workflow ids so reconnects and concurrent updates cannot leave stale worker-agent cards. Prefer slot customPrompt over generated default. Expose getWorkerAgentsFromWorkflows mock in SpaceIsland suite.

* perf: lazy-load workflow details for configure agents

Move bulk spaceWorkflow.get fetches out of shared ensureConfigData path into ensureWorkflowDetails, called only by SpaceConfigurePage. Prevents N per-workflow RPCs on every SpaceTaskPane/SpaceGoals/SpaceLongHorizonAgents mount and reconnect refresh.

* fix: chain workflow details after config, reset on reconnect

Chain ensureWorkflowDetails after ensureConfigData in SpaceConfigurePage and refresh() so cold-start snapshots populate summaries first. Reset workflowDetailsLoaded/promise in refresh() so reconnect re-fetches. Add ensureWorkflowDetails tests covering fan-out, idempotency, dedup, reset, and race guards.

* fix: merge workflow details and retry on partial failure

Merge fan-out results with event-applied state so workflows created concurrently are preserved. Keep workflowDetailsLoaded false when any detail RPC fails so the next Configure mount retries instead of sticking on partial data. Add tests for both cases.

* fix(web): address remaining codex review threads

- Key worker agent cards by agentId+slot name so dist... (continued)

20736 of 108588 relevant lines covered (19.1%)

10.03 hits per line

Source Files on job daemon-online-rpc-3 - 27874317081.28
  • Tree
  • List 355
  • Changed 0
  • Source Changed 0
  • Coverage Changed 0
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Build 27874317081
  • 011d8eb2 on github
  • Prev Job for on dev (#27873298894.26)
  • Next Job for on dev (#27876217228.7)
  • Delete
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c